Rap battleRanī Nōzu

The comedy duo Lani Nose has a rap battle sketch that’s actually available as a karaoke track! First, Suzaki goes first and delivers a sharp, clean rap, but Yamada, who goes second, gets nervous and can only blurt out silly nonsense and goofy lines.

However, when Suzaki smacks him on the head and he pulls up his hood… he suddenly starts firing off brilliant raps one after another! There’s even a detailed setup where the content of the rap changes depending on the type of hat he puts on.

Be sure to prepare a variety of hats and try recreating Lani Nose’s routine at karaoke!

Just barely Showa-eraKyūso Nekokami

Kyuso Nekokami – “Barely Showa ~Complete Version~” [Official Music Video]
Just barely Showa-eraKyūso Nekokami

Kyuso Nekokami has lots of fun, upbeat tracks you can really get into.

From the title alone, Giri Showa sounds intriguing, and it’s a song that reflects the half-lives of members born right at the tail end of the Showa era and their feelings toward the Heisei era.

The word “Reiwa” appears in the lyrics, and the music video released right after the new era name was announced also drew attention.

If you’re from the same generation as Kyuso—often called the “Yutori generation”—this is a track you’ll likely relate to and get hyped for.

The call-and-response with the era names really gets the crowd going!

Smooch! Summer PartySannin Matsuri

3nin Matsuri – Chu! Natsu Party (Kiss! Summer Party)
Smooch! Summer PartySannin Matsuri

This song is a summer track released in 2001 as part of Hello! Project’s shuffle unit initiative.

The members are a star-studded trio: Ai Kago, Rika Ishikawa, and Aya Matsuura.

It’s such an adorable song that it’s sure to work well as an attention-grabbing opener.

YES MAXUchikubi Gokumon Doukoukai

A lot of Uchikubi Gokumon Doukoukai’s songs are perfect as gag picks for karaoke, aren’t they? “YES MAX” is a collaboration track with Acecook’s cup noodles Super Cup, and its quirky lyrics became a hot topic.

The hilarious music video is a must-see too!
